Why a 6 Inch Chimney Cap Is Necessary

I learned that a 6 inch chimney cap is more than just a small metal cover—it is an important part of protecting my chimney and fireplace system. It helps keep rain, snow, leaves, and other debris from falling inside the flue, which can cause damage or block airflow. Without it, moisture can build up and lead to rust, deterioration, and costly repairs over time.

I also found that a chimney cap helps keep animals out. Birds, squirrels, and other small creatures can easily make their way into an open chimney, where they may build nests or become trapped. A proper 6 inch cap gives me peace of mind by preventing these problems before they start.

Another reason I consider it necessary is safety. A chimney cap can help reduce the risk of sparks escaping and can improve the overall performance of my chimney by keeping the system cleaner and more protected. For me, it is a simple addition that offers long-term protection, better maintenance, and fewer headaches.

Check the Exact Chimney Flue Size

The first thing I do is confirm that my chimney flue is truly 6 inches. I never rely only on guesswork because even a small sizing mistake can lead to poor fit or installation issues. I measure carefully, and if I’m unsure, I check the manufacturer’s specifications or ask a professional.

Choose the Right Material

Material matters a lot to me because it affects durability and weather resistance. I usually compare these options:

  • Stainless steel: My top choice for long-lasting rust resistance.
  • Galvanized steel: More affordable, but I know it may not last as long.
  • Copper: Attractive and durable, though usually more expensive.

If I want a cap that can handle harsh weather, I lean toward stainless steel or copper.

Look at the Design and Protection Features

I pay close attention to the cap’s design because not all caps protect the same way. I prefer a model with a mesh screen to block leaves, birds, and small animals. I also look for a sloped or hooded top so rain and snow do not enter the chimney easily. The better the design, the less maintenance I usually need later.

Make Sure It Fits My Chimney Type

Not every 6 inch chimney cap works for every chimney. I check whether my chimney is:

  • Single-flue
  • Multi-flue
  • Masonry or metal

I always match the cap style to my chimney type so I get a secure and proper installation.

Consider Ease of Installation

I prefer a chimney cap that I can install without too much hassle. Some models clamp on easily, while others may require screws or professional help. If I’m planning to do it myself, I look for clear instructions, included hardware, and a simple mounting system.

Check for Weather Resistance

Since my chimney is exposed to the elements, I want a cap that can stand up to wind, rain, snow, and heat. I look for rustproof finishes, strong welds, and sturdy construction. In my experience, a well-built cap lasts much longer and performs better in all seasons.

Think About Maintenance

I like products that are easy to clean and inspect. A chimney cap with a removable screen or accessible design makes maintenance simpler for me. I also check whether the mesh openings are small enough to keep pests out but large enough to avoid clogging from soot or creosote buildup.

Compare Price and Value

I don’t always choose the cheapest option. Instead, I look for the best value. A low-cost cap may save money upfront, but if it rusts or fits poorly, I may end up replacing it sooner. I usually balance price with material quality, warranty, and overall durability.

Read Reviews and Warranty Information

Before I buy, I always read customer reviews. They help me learn how the cap performs in real homes, not just in product descriptions. I also check the warranty because it gives me confidence in the product’s quality and the manufacturer’s support.
